Some cancers run in families – knowing your risk can make all the difference. It is estimated that around 1 in 8 men will be diagnosed with prostate cancer with up to 10% of prostate cancers thought to be inherited. Our genetic prostate cancer test looks for mutations in 14 key genes associated with increased risk. With this insight you can make informed decisions to help protect your health.
If you have a family history of prostate cancer, breast cancer or ovarian cancer, it might mean you are at increased risk of prostate cancer due to a genetic mutation. It is important to note, having a gene mutation linked to prostate cancer doesn’t mean you will develop prostate cancer, but it can increase your risk. Not sure if genetic testing is right for you?
